Mamie S. Brown

Mrs. Mamie S. Brown, 84, formerly of 816 Clover St., died today in St. Anthony's Hospital, Michigan City, after a short illness. She had resided in the home of her daughter, Mrs. W. W. Lewis, Michigan City, for the last year. She was born on Nov. 24, 1882, in De Witt, Mo., and came to South Bend 24 years ago from Tefft, Ind.

In addition to Mrs. Lewis, she is survived by two daughters, Mrs. Grace Thompson of Royal Center, Ind., and Mrs. Leona Crawford of South Bend; five sons, Rev. Raymond Brown of Michigan City, Orville of Ithaca, N. Y., Cleatis of New Carlisle, Ross of Bremen and Edgar of South Bend; 21 grandchildren and 36 great-grandchildren; four sisters, Mrs. Clara Downs of Anton, Tex., Mrs. Nellie Wininger of Elk City, Okla., Mrs. Ethel Bennett of Independence, Kan., and Mrs. Blanche Shaw of Breckenridge, Tex.; and four brothers, Fred Adkins of Independence, Kan., George Lindsey of Oklahoma, Wilber of Aurora, Mo., and Ralph of Bremen.

Friends may call after 7 p.m. Thursday in the Forest G. Hay and Son Funeral Home. Rev. Robert Whitehead, of Niles, will officiate at services at 1:30 p.m. Saturday in the funeral home. Burial will be in Southlawn Cemetery.

Mrs. Brown was a member of Pentecostal Holiness Church, Michigan City.
